    The only Yoko Kanno songs I listen are those she wrote for Maaya Sakamoto.. esp Vision of Escaflowne theme.. its perhaps the nicest catch anime tune ever IMHO..

    I actually have all of Maaya's albums.. her voice is fairly easy to the ears, again.. really easy going esp from a stressful day..

    My Jrock albums are mostly from Yellow Monkey, Luna Sea, La'cryma Christi, L'Arc~En~Ciel and a host of other bands.. Sometimes I might go for GLAY but IMO far too corny for my own liking..

    Jpop goes from anything into older DREAM, Do as Infinity etc..

    And yes.. once in a while Initial D tunes are pretty ok too.. MOVE is relative small for all accounts, but the song they make are pretty nice for periodic hearing IMO anyways..
